🥘 Ingredients

8 items
  • 4 large sweet potatoes
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 0.25 cup heavy cream
  • 2 tablespoons maple syrup
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 0.25 teaspoon nutmeg
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on ground black pepper

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Peel the sweet potatoes and cut them into 1-inch chunks for even cooking.

2

Place the sweet potato chunks into a large pot and cover them with cold water. Add a pinch of salt to the water.

3

Bring the pot to a boil over medium-high heat and cook the sweet potatoes for about 20 minutes or until they are fork-tender.

4

Drain the sweet potatoes well and return them to the pot.

5

Add the butter to the hot sweet potatoes and allow it to melt.

6

Pour in the heavy cream and maple syrup, then add the ground cinnamon, nutmeg, salt, and black pepper.

7

Using a potato masher or an electric hand mixer, mash the sweet potatoes until smooth and creamy. Adjust seasoning to taste if necessary.

8

Serve the mashed sweet potatoes warm as a flavorful side dish, garnished with a light sprinkle of cinnamon if desired.
